When Hard Work Becomes a Survival Pattern

from The Simple Source: Self-Love, Healing, and Spiritual Growth · host Linda Villines

You don't have to earn your worth. In this episode, I'm going deep on one of the most normalized and misunderstood patterns I see in healing work: the belief that your worth has to be earned through effort, exhaustion, and struggle. Not as a mindset problem, but as a somatic one. We talk about where that conditioning actually comes from, why it gets wired into your physiology before you even have language for it, and why hustle culture, family systems, and collective programming have all conspired to make struggling feel like identity. If you've ever felt guilty for resting, anxious when things feel easy, or like hard work is what defines your success, this episode is going to name exactly what's happening in your body and why.We also get into what real release looks like, how struggle unwinds not through intensity but through subtle somatic shifts that re-teach your system that neutrality, softness, and stillness are safe again. I walk you through what actually happens in your body when you try to relax, why shame gets activated, and how the smallest micro-releases begin rewiring your baseline identity from survival to authenticity. If you’re tired of feeling like rest has to be earned, or like ease is something you have to deserve, this episode will change how you relate to your own joy and peace.
